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age issues early is crucial to preventing further damage and costly repairs. Here are some common warning signs that you may need Condo Water Damage Rest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your condo, it could be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by mold growth, which can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by leaks, floods, or other water-related issues.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by moisture seeping into the flooring, causing it to warp or buckle.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by moisture seeping into the walls, causing the paint or wallpaper to peel or blister.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Unexplained mold growth in your condo can be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by moisture seeping into the walls, causing mold to grow.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els in your condo can be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by moisture seeping into the walls, causing the humidity levels to rise.
Condo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water stain on the wall | Yes | No | Easy to clean and repair yourself. |
| Flooding in the condo due to burst pipe |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ively clean and dry the area. |
| Musty smell in the condo | Maybe | Yes | Could be a sign of mold growth, which needs professional attention to safely and effectively remove. |
| Water damage to the condo’s structural elements | No | Yes | Needs specialized expertise and equipment to safely and effectively repair and replace structural elements. |
| Small leak under the sink | Yes | No | Easy to fix yourself with basic plumbing tools and knowledge. |
| Condo-wide flooding due to storm damage |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ively clean and dry the entire condo. |

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Holly Springs, GA
The cost of Condo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Holly Springs, GA.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, duration of drying process |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, materials used |
| Insurance Claims Handling |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claims process, number of claims submitted |
